Shell eggs broken up 2%

Shell eggs broken totaled 163 million dozen during December 2008, up 2% from December a year ago, and 2% above the 160 million broken last month, according to the U.S. Department of Agriculture.

During calendar year 2008 through December, shell eggs broken totaled 2.05 billion dozen, up 3% from the comparable period in 2007, the department says in its January 30 Egg Products report.

To date, cumulative total edible product from eggs broken in 2008 was 2.68 billion pounds, up 3% from 2007.

Data presented in this report were compiled from Food Safety and Inspection Service (FSIS) inspection reports.
